Этот курс — ваш инструментальный набор для новой эпохи разработки. Принципиальный подход к программированию с ИИ помогает не просто использовать AI‑ассистентов, а системно выстраивать работу так, чтобы они становились естественным продолжением вашей инженерной практики и давали вам реальное, измеримое преимущество.
Почему принципиальное AI-программирование меняет правила игры
AI‑кодинг меняет саму модель мышления инженера: от ручного написания кода — к управлению процессом генерации решений. Сильные специалисты будущего — те, кто умеет точно формулировать задачу, управлять контекстом и направлять модель, а не слепо полагаться на первый ответ.
Курс даёт не очередную подборку инструментов, а универсальные принципы, применимые к любой модели, стеку или домену. Это фундамент, который не устаревает.
Ключевые компетенции, которые вы освоите
Чёткая постановка контекста
Вы научитесь передавать модели именно ту информацию, которая позволяет ей генерировать качественные результаты. Большинство ошибок AI‑ассистентов — следствие неправильного или неполного контекста, и мы разберём, как формировать его правильно.
Выбор подходящей модели
Мы рассмотрим, какие модели использовать для разных задач: от генерации кода до анализа архитектуры и создания проектных решений. Вы научитесь понимать сильные и слабые стороны моделей и выбирать оптимальную под конкретный сценарий.
Проектирование точных промптов
Вы получите принципы написания промптов, которые позволяют AI выполнять за вас основную работу: генерировать функции, модули, пайплайны и целые фичи за минуты. Мы разберём паттерны промпт‑инжиниринга для сложных инженерных задач.
Что делает этот курс уникальным
- Фокус на мышлении инженера, а не на конкретных инструментах.
- Принципы, которые не устареют, даже если модели и приложения сменятся.
- Практическая направленность: вы будете применять техники на реальных инженерных задачах.
- Универсальность: подходит для любого уровня — от новичка до senior‑разработчика.
Структура курса: 8 уроков — 8 ключевых принципов
Каждый урок раскрывает один принцип AI‑программирования и формирует ваше новое инженерное мышление. В результате вы научитесь работать быстрее, уменьшать количество ручной рутины и передавать AI‑ассистенту до 70–90% разработки.
Практическая ценность, которую вы получите
Новые developer‑workflow’ы
Вы выстроите современные процессы разработки, где AI‑ассистент — активный участник, а не вспомогательный инструмент.
Ускорение решения сложных задач
Вы узнаете, как применять AI для:
- рефакторинга больших кодовых баз,
- генерации архитектурных решений,
- работы с legacy‑проектами,
- разработки новых фич,
- исследования проблем и оптимизации.
Умение передавать работу AI
Ключевой вопрос инженера новой эпохи: «Как эффективно делегировать эту задачу AI‑ассистенту?» К концу курса вы сможете уверенно отвечать на него в любой ситуации — от прототипирования до продакшн‑разработки.
Кому подойдёт этот курс
- Инженерам, которые только начинают работать с AI‑моделями.
- Опытным разработчикам, желающим кратно повысить эффективность.
- Тимлидам и архитекторам, стремящимся внедрить AI‑подходы в процессы команды.
- Специалистам, следящим за развитием технологий и желающим двигаться быстрее рынка.
Что вы получите в итоге
Осмысленный, структурированный и принципиальный подход к AI‑программированию, который позволит вам не просто «пользоваться ассистентом», а работать на новом уровне инженерного мастерства.
Вы перестанете соревноваться с AI — вы начнёте управлять им.